Class SequenceClosedException

  • All Implemented Interfaces:
    Serializable

    public class SequenceClosedException
    extends AbstractSoapFaultException
    This fault is generated by an RM Destination to indicate that the specified Sequence has been closed. This fault MUST be generated when an RM Destination is asked to accept a message for a Sequence that is closed. Properties: [Code] Sender [Subcode] wsrm:SequenceClosed [Reason] The Sequence is closed and cannot accept new messages. [Detail] xs:anyURI Generated by: RM Source or RM Destination. Condition : In response to a message that belongs to a Sequence that is already closed. Action Upon Generation : Unspecified. Action Upon Receipt : Sequence closed.
